logo

Output 61c3ae75919c49afcc4d52999aacf7398e1ca4e05e6eef3fb63c3273091f3cb1:109

value
38370920
script pubkey
OP_0 OP_PUSHBYTES_20 70866cdde42ace8df6fa6986e826777a7befbb44
address
bc1qwzrxeh0y9t8gmah6dxrwsfnh0fa7lw6y8gsmv6
transaction
61c3ae75919c49afcc4d52999aacf7398e1ca4e05e6eef3fb63c3273091f3cb1